infjeff wrote:

Personally, I wouldn't mind a compilation movie a la Nanoha (note that I haven't seen the Nanoha movie).


The Nanoha movie isn't a compilation movie, it's a retelling of the series. Some of the events are the similar, but it's completely new animation. It's how I'd expect a Madoka movie to play out, but I think they'd throw in a different ending if they went that route.
